Missouri's housing stock features a variety of home styles, many equipped with sliding glass doors. The humid summers can cause materials to swell, making doors difficult to operate, while winter's cold and moisture can lead to ice buildup in tracks and potential frame damage. Debris accumulation in tracks is also a common issue, especially after windy spring days.

When evaluating the expense of sliding glass door repair, the specific problem is the primary driver. A door that is difficult to slide, has worn-out rollers, or features damaged glass requires different diagnostic and repair steps. The complexity of the repair, the availability of specific replacement parts, and the labor involved are the main determinants of cost. We focus on precise diagnosis and clear communication.

How do you fix a sliding door that will not slide smoothly?

To fix a sliding door that is not sliding smoothly, we first inspect the tracks for debris or damage. We then examine the rollers for wear or breakage. Cleaning the tracks and lubricating or replacing the rollers typically resolves the sticking issue.
